This shoot in the style workshop focuses on the incredible work of MARTIN PARR. To honour his life and work we are taking a day trip to the seaside town of Brighton when we'll find familiar Parr scenes.

Martin Parr's work embodies a classic "love-hate relationship" with Britain, with a sharp eye to capture both the endearing traditions and the awkward, consumerist, or divisive aspects, often through wry humour, parody, and whilst exploring complex national identity and social quirks.
